상세 컨텐츠

본문 제목

Drozer 설치 (Windows)

REVERSING/Android

by koharin 2021. 7. 6. 17:33

본문

728x90
반응형

Prerequisite

시스템 환경변수 편집 -> 환경변수 -> 시스템 변수 -> Path에 python2와 python2 내 Scripts 폴더 경로를 Path 맨 위에 위치시킨다.

환경변수를 이렇게 설정해야 drozer를 사용할 수 있다.

 

설치 파일 다운로드

Release 2.4.4 · FSecureLABS/drozer

 

Release 2.4.4 · FSecureLABS/drozer

[Build Process] AppVeyor updated to deploy Windows installer [Build Process] Fixed versioning of whl, deb and rpm packages [Bug Fixes] Several bug fixes

github.com

위 링크에서 drozer-2.4.4.win32.msi 파일을 다운받는다.

Drozer

 

Drozer

 

labs.f-secure.com

위 링크에서는 drozer-agent-2.3.4.apk 파일을 받는다.

 

 

Installing .msi (Windows)

pip install protobuf pyopenssl twisted # dependency 설치
drozer-2.4.4.win32.msi # 실행

python2.7 경로로 지정해서 설치한다.

그럼 위와 같이 drozer 명령어를 사용할 수 있다.

 

 

Android Emulator에 Drozer Agent 설치 & 실행

adb install drozer-agent-2.3.4.apk

Drozer Agent 앱을 실행하고, 하단의 Embedded Server를 클릭한다.

Enabled로 설정하면, embedded server가 31415 포트에서 실행된다.

 

 

drozer 사용

$ adb -s emulator-5554 forward tcp:31415 tcp:31415 # port forwarding
31415

$ drozer console connect # connect to drozer

포트 포워딩 후, drozer console connect로 drozer를 실행한다.

728x90
반응형

관련글 더보기